Heterozygote advantage is the condition where the heterozygous individual has higher relative fitness than both homozygous dominant and homozygous recessive individual. This means that the heterozygote individual has higher chances of surviving than both the homozygous counterparts. Sickle cell anemia is a recessive inherited disorder in which oxygen carrying hemoglobin has an abnormal structure. Hence, the resultant RBCs are not spherical but have crescent sickle shape. The oxygen carrying capacity of such RBCs is drastically reduced but they are unaffected by malarial parasite due to their abnormal structure.
- A person with both the recessive genes for sickle cell would not be able to survive due to insufficient oxygen transport in body.
- A person with both the dominant genes would be free of sickle cell anemia but in case of malaria would not be able to survive as the normal RBCs would be hijacked by the parasite.
- A hetrerozygote would survive both in malaria and sickle cell condition since he has enough normal RBCs for oxygen transport but also has sickle cell RBCs which are unaffected by malarial parasite.

<h3>What is medulla oblongata?</h3>
Medulla oblongata is the lowest part of the brain and brainstem . The medulla oblongata is linked up to the midbrain by pons.
The medulla oblongata function well in the regulation of autonomic nervous system, such as respiration, cardiac function, vasodilation, and some reflexes actions like vomiting, sneezing coughing and so on.

This would be an example of an energy pyramid! In an energy pyramid, the next trophic level gets only 10% of the energy from the level below it. In this example, lets say that there is 100 energy in the eggs. Then, 10% of that goes to the snake, so the snake gets 10. Lastly, the hawk eats the snake, so the hawk gets 1.
